NEWS
Ausführen von z.B. Sudo auf Synology
-
Hallo zusammen, ich habe es doch tatsächlich geschafft, iobroker auf meiner DS213j zu installieren. läuft soweit auch alles. selbst die Verbindung von KNX auf Sonos hab ich nach langem probieren hin bekommen.
Jetzt möchte ich den homekit2 adapter installieren, für den man anscheinend noch zusätzliche Pakete installieren muss.
so z.B. "libavahi-compat-libdnssd-dev" dieses soll über den Befehl "sudo apt-get install libavahi-compat-libdnssd-dev" installiert werden. wie bzw. wo führe ich den Befehl sudo aus? Auf der Synology? Im iobroker? Ich hab beides versucht, im broker terminal installiert und darüber versucht- nix. Bei der DS hab ich kein Terminal gefunden… und jetzt?
Soviel ich weiß ist sudo ein Linux-Befehl- müsste also eigentlich auf der Diskstation ausgeführt werden. Gibt es keinen direkten install-Befehl für den iobroker ?
bin über jeden Hinweis dankbar
-
Du musst den befehl als Root auf der Synology-Shell ausführen.
Also du musst SSH freischalten (geht irgendwo in den Synology Settings) und dann kannst DU per SSH verbinden und mal schauen … ob es klappt weiss aber keiner ...
-
Vielen Dank!
Das anmelden als root per SSH auf der Synology hat schonmal geklappt.
Nun möchte ich den Befehl ausführen. der Befehl sudo apt-get install libavahi-compat-libdnssd-dev wird allerdings nicht bearbeitet. folgende Meldung erscheint :
sudo: apt-get: command not found
mach ich was falsch ?
Gruss
-
Naja, die Synology ist halt kein vollwertiges Linux … und damit ist mein Latein am Ende ... Stöbere mal, es gibt wegen eine "chroot" auf der Synology rum laufen zu bekommen ... aber da bin ich Wissenstechnisch raus
-
nur mal als tip, man solltee dafuer Docker benutzen.
Das synology system ist zar linux aber nicht gedacht fuer 3rd party installation das kan auch problemen mit deinem NAS geben.
Docker loest dies fuer dich, wie eine VM auf synology und komplett lose vom NAS.
~Dutch
-
Docker ist super…allerdings für die 213j nicht zu bekommen. Dafür ist sie zu schwach auf der Brust.
Ich versuch mich noch ein wenig ins Thema Synology und Kommandozeilen-Befehle einzuarbeiten.
Danke erstmal für deine Hilfe
-
Naja, die Synology ist halt kein vollwertiges Linux … und damit ist mein Latein am Ende ... Stöbere mal, es gibt wegen eine "chroot" auf der Synology rum laufen zu bekommen ... aber da bin ich Wissenstechnisch raus `
Ich werd mal schauen, was da möglich ist. Ansonsten wie unten schon beschrieben : ne größere/neuere DS und dann per Docker iobroker ans laufen bringen.
Danke für deine Hilfe
-
Wenn du als Root angemeldet bist brauchst du kein sudo versuche mal den Befehl so
apt install libavahi-compat-libdnssd-dev
Hier sind die Grundlegenden Befehle für deinen Synology
http://www.synology-wiki.de/index.php/G … mandozeile
Einen Install Befehl konnte ich aber nicht finden.